Sellers scores 24 points, Howell adds double-double and No. 25 Washington women top Penn State 81-65
The Huskies led 38-37 at halftime before outscoring Penn State 43-28 in the second half.
Washington opened the third quarter on a 2-for-10 shooting slump but made 6 of 7 free throws in the first 4 1/2 minutes to lead 48-44. Sellers scored nine of the Huskies' 22 points in the quarter and they led 60-51 heading to the fourth.
Howell opened the fourth quarter with a 3-pointer and the Huskies led by double digits for the final eight minutes. The lead reached 19 at 79-60 and again at 81-62 in the final minute.
Howell had 13 points and 12 rebounds for her third double-double of the season. Brynn McGaughy had 14 points and nine rebounds off the bench for Washington (15-4, 5-3 Big Ten).
Gracie Merkle scored 19 points and Kiyomi McMiller had 11 for Penn State (7-13, 0-9).
McGaughy scored 10 points on 5-for-5 shooting in the first quarter and the Huskies took a 21-11 lead. The Nittany Lions scored 26 points in the second quarter to cut their deficit to a point.
The Huskies have won six of their last seven conference home games dating to last season.
Washington: The Huskies play Sunday at Rutgers.
